Thread
:
Television Sucks These Days
View Single Post
01-30-2006, 12:47 PM
26MLR
Confirmed User
Join Date: Dec 2005
Location: USA
Posts: 401
That new Jenna Elfman show is pretty good.
26MLR
View Public Profile
Find More Posts by 26MLR